UAE ambassador hails ties as Jordan marks centennial

By JT - Apr 11,2021 - Last updated at Apr 11,2021

AMMAN — The Kingdom’s celebrations of its centennial are also Emirati celebrations, especially that Jordan has turned into a modern state that seeks to achieve welfare to its citizens, Emirati Ambassador to Jordan Ahmed Ali Balushi said on Saturday.

Balushi also said that Jordan and the UAE enjoy “distinguished” economic and investment relations, where non-oil trade exchange volume in 2019 stood at $2.836 billion, noting that UAE investments in the Kingdom exceeded $17 billion, mainly covering infrastructure, transport, tourism, agricultural, industrial and renewable energy sectors.

On the other hand, Jordanian investments in the UAE exceed $2 billion, mainly in the real estate sector, the diplomat said. As for the Palestinian cause, he stressed that both countries share similar stances on mechanisms of supporting the cause according to the two-state solution that can lead to the establishment of an independent Palestinian state on the pre-1967 lines with east Jerusalem as its capital.
